Damage to your vehicle
The injuries and damage that are associated with truck crashes are usually much more severe than those of regular passenger vehicle accidents. The greater size and weight of semi-trucks means that they are more likely to cause injury and damage when they collide with smaller vehicles. Many trucking firms, as well their drivers, are required to carry a higher degree of insurance than regular auto insurers. This usually includes liability coverage that exceeds $1 million.
The total amount of compensation paid to victims of a semi truck accident could be greater than the compensation for an ordinary auto collision. This is because there are numerous kinds of damages which can be claimed. These include both economic and non-economic damages.
Economic damages comprise the cost of any property damage caused by the accident, as well as medical expenses and lost wages. These are all considered as a direct result of the accident, and therefore, they can be recovered in your claim.
